Abstract

The invention discloses polishing equipment for an automobile bumper, which comprises an arc-shaped bearing plate, wherein a polishing mechanism is arranged on the arc-shaped bearing plate. The polishing device has the advantages of being convenient to use, adjust the polishing position, adjust the polishing feed amount and fix well during moving.

Polishing equipment for automobile bumper
Technical Field
The invention relates to the field of polishing, in particular to polishing equipment for an automobile bumper.
Background
Polishing is an operation that allows a tool to smooth the surface of an object.
Along with the continuous development of society, people's standard of living is also improving constantly, the family that possess the car volume is also more, in order to guarantee people's safety and the safety of vehicle, need place the bumper around the vehicle, if the bumper falls to paint in colliding with, it is convenient to touch up with lacquer, need polish smoothly with colliding with the department, also need polish after touch up with lacquer, be convenient for make to merge well, the instrument that traditional polishing and polishing used is all that the manual work is handheld adjusts the input, but it is inhomogeneous as far as possible to hold always, and long-time handheld intensity is also great, consequently, in order to solve the problem, also for better satisfying the needs, it is very necessary to design a polishing equipment for car bumper.

Each hand-held handle is sleeved with a hand-held soft layer.
And the side surface of each first rotating motor is provided with a connecting power line.
The arc loading board outside surface just is located a pair of arc opening processing all around and has three arc through-hole, every all be equipped with arc transparent glass in the arc through-hole.
The arc-shaped bearing plate is an elastic bearing plate.
The polishing wheel is characterized in that the arc-shaped bearing plate is arranged on the inner side of the polishing wheel and located on two sides of the pair of rotating polishing wheels, the folding fixing frames are fixedly connected with the inner side surfaces of the folding fixing frames, each elastic bearing rod is arranged on the inner side surface of each folding fixing frame, and the cleaning soft brush is sleeved on each elastic bearing rod.
The arc-shaped bearing plate is characterized in that arc-shaped elastic shielding strips are fixedly connected to the upper end face and the lower end face of the arc-shaped bearing plate, and two pairs of fixing screws are arranged on the outer sides of the arc-shaped elastic shielding strips and between the side surfaces of the arc-shaped bearing plate.
The diameters of the pair of rotating polishing wheels are the same and the widths of the rotating polishing wheels are different.
Each hand-holding handle is provided with a pair of folding stretching rods between the hand-holding handles and the outer side surface of the arc-shaped bearing plate.
The rotating direction of each rotating polishing wheel is perpendicular to the arc-shaped bearing plate.

In this embodiment, when the device is used, the arc-shaped bearing plate 1 is close to the outer side of the bumper, because the arc-shaped bearing plate 1 is elastic, two pairs of extrusion screws 9 positioned at two sides of the arc-shaped bearing plate 1 can be extruded, the fixed radian is adjusted, wherein the arc-shaped adsorption block 10 positioned on the end surface of each extrusion screw 9 is conveniently adsorbed on the outer side surface of the bumper well, so that the device is well fixed, when moving and polishing are carried out, each hand-holding handle 7 can be manually held to move, so that each support universal wheel 16 in the device can move along with the movement, so that the device can move, wherein each arc-shaped adsorption block 10 can be adsorbed and moved along with the surface of the bumper, each support universal wheel 16 is connected with a pair of vertical screwing screws 14 through the support bearing plate 15, each support bearing plate 15 can adjust the lifting position along with the screwing of the pair of vertical screwing screws 14, wherein each pair of vertical screwing screws 14 are connected with the vertical supporting rods 12 through the supporting plate 13, each pair of vertical supporting rods 12 is connected with a pair of extrusion screws 9 through the arc-shaped supporting frame 11, so that the supporting is good, and the height is adjusted, wherein a pair of rotary polishing wheels 5 in the device are convenient to rotate through the driving of a rotary belt 6 when a connecting power line 18 of each rotary motor 4 is connected with an external power supply, each rotary polishing wheel 5 is contacted with the surface of a safety rod for rotary polishing, wherein each rotary motor 4 moves along with the corresponding strip-shaped moving frame 3 to adjust the polishing depth, each hand-holding handle 7 is fixed on the outer side of the strip-shaped moving frame 3 and is convenient to hold and adjust the position, and a plurality of strip-shaped limiting bulges 2 which are positioned in the arc-shaped bearing plate 1 and correspond to each strip-shaped moving frame 3 are convenient to effectively limit the moving speed, wherein the scale 8 on the side surface of each bar-shaped moving frame 3 is convenient to correspond to the outer surface of the arc-shaped bearing plate 1 at any moment, the pushing or pulling length is displayed, the polishing degree is adjusted, the hand-holding soft layer 17 on each hand-holding handle 7 is convenient to hold, three arc-shaped transparent glasses 19 on the side surface of the arc-shaped bearing plate 1 and on the outer side of the bar-shaped moving frame 3 are convenient to observe the polished position, a pair of cleaning soft brushes 22 on the inner side of the arc-shaped bearing plate 1 are convenient to rotate on the corresponding elastic bearing rods 21 during the moving process before and after polishing, and are elastic, so that different shapes can be cleaned conveniently, each elastic bearing rod 21 is fixed with the inner surface of the arc-shaped bearing plate 1 through a folded fixing frame 20, and the arc-shaped elastic shielding strips 23 on the upper and lower surfaces of the arc-shaped bearing plate 1 are convenient to shield polished sparks, each of the arc-shaped elastic shielding strips 23 is connected with the end surface of the arc-shaped bearing plate 1 through two pairs of fixing screws 24, so that the fixing is good, and the shielding strips are elastic and can be adapted to shielding in different shapes, and the folding stretching rod 25 between each of the hand-holding handles 7 and the side surface of the arc-shaped bearing plate 1 can be pulled to be fixed at a proper position.
